SECTION 1 : Job Summary

A Doctor's Assistant is a valuable asset to an optometrist as they assist in providing a world class Total Patient Experience.

This team member is able to handle a wide range of duties while using optical equipment to perform the initial testing needed to prepare a patient for an exam with an Optometrist.

SECTION 2 : Duties and Responsibilities (Responsibilities necessary to accomplish job functions)

  • Embrace and execute our Total Patient Experience to build relationships with all patients while delivering great medical support
  • Display a professional attitude, greet patients promptly with a smile, and thank them when they leave
  • Comply with all company policies and procedures including HIPAA
  • Practice urgency at all times placing value on a patient's time, as well as the doctor's time and schedule
  • Operate manual lensometer, auto-lensometer, autorefractor / keratometer, retinal camera, visual field, GDX or OCT
  • Follow scripting for testing equipment (photos, visual fields, visual activity, etc.)
  • Clean all examination equipment including tonometer tip
  • Set phoropter to patient RX or re-set to plano (per doctor's request)

Location : Work takes place in a normal office / clinical environment. Travel to other locations may be necessary to fulfill essential duties and responsibilities of the job.

Thus, those needing to travel for work must have access to dependable transportation, and driving record must meet company liability carrier standards.

Exposure : Works in normal office environment during normal business hours. May be exposed to blood or bodily fluids. May also be exposed to various cleaning supplies.

Equipment : Regularly uses Optometric equipment / devices per sub-specialty requirement such as lensometer; keratometer / autorefractor ;

phoropter; visual acuity measuring; retinal camera; corneal topography unit; retinoscope; telephone, computer, fax, printer and copier.

Other equipment may be used as needed. Must be able to work with precise tools and equipment; must have dexterity to use these items correctly and safely.
